How can we identify a fake Clinton story in the NT Times?

2 answers
2024-11-19 18:22

One way is to cross - check with other reliable news sources. If a story in the NT Times about Clinton seems out of the ordinary and no other respected media is reporting it, it could be suspect. Also, look for sources within the story. If they are anonymous or seem untrustworthy, it might be a sign of a fake story.

What are the implications when man creates a fake Clinton story in the New York Times?

1 answer
2024-11-06 21:01

Well, it can have multiple implications. Politically, it can affect public perception of Clinton and potentially influence elections or political debates. Socially, it can create division among the public as some will believe the false story and others will defend Clinton. Also, from a media perspective, it questions the reliability of the New York Times' editorial process.

What does it mean that the New York Times retracts Clinton Tulsi story?

1 answer
2024-11-21 07:32

The retraction of the Clinton Tulsi story by the New York Times implies that there were problems with the story they originally published. This could be due to a variety of reasons. For instance, the journalists might have been misled by sources with their own agendas. Or perhaps there was a miscommunication within the editorial process. This retraction is important as it aims to set the record straight. It also has implications for the credibility of the New York Times. If they make such a mistake, it makes people wonder about the reliability of their other stories as well. However, it is also a sign that they are willing to correct their errors, which is a positive aspect in the world of journalism.
